Steroid Hormones
Hormones derived from cholesterol and secreted by the sex
organs-ovaries and testes and the adrenal cortex.
-Estrone
-Testosterone
-Cortisol
Monoamine Hormones
Derived from aromatic amino acids
-Dopamine
-Norepinephrine
Peptide Hormones
Consist of long peptide chains
-Oxytocin
-Insulin
-Adrenocorticotropic hormone
-Thyroid hormones
-Glucagon
